All American Apple Pie
It was one of the few times I made a pie and it turned out great. "All American" is really the adjective that describes it. It tasted and looked like one of the pies that one can purchase in stores and fast-food places, Only it was better because it was home-made, and if one wishes to cut some calories, one can cut out the butter and oil content. I put half less of butter and oil, a bit less flour, and some more milk. I also used olive oil because vegetable oil was aparently missing in my home. As for spices I added some allspice in addition to cinnamon. I loved the crunchy shell and crust and the light brown look of the pie.
